Ford Thunderbird Air Bag Parts and Q&A

  • Q: How to reactivate the air bag system on Ford Thunderbird?
    A:
    You should disconnect the battery negative cable before starting any air bag system reactivation steps. The first step of the process includes removing the diagnostic tool from the driver side safety belt retractor pretensioner electrical connector before connecting this connector to its position and engaging the locking clip. Place the driver side rear trim panel with the speaker grille while keeping the safety belt tongue free for use. Secure the safety belt inside the driver seat guide without twist and then install the driver side door weather-stripping with the scuff plate. The diagnostic tool must come from beneath the driver seat to transfer it from the floor electrical connector of the driver seat side air bag. Connect the driver seat side air bag electrical connector. Perform this operation again on the passenger compartment by removing the diagnostic tool from the passenger side safety belt retractor pretensioner electrical connector and subsequently connecting and securing it with the locking clip. The passenger side rear trim panel should be installed with speaker grille as the safety belt tongue must stay accessible while positioning the safety belt back into the passenger seat guide untwisted before installing passenger side door weather-stripping and scuff plate. The diagnostic tool under the passenger seat requires removal from the side air bag floor electric connector and then needs reconnection to this point. Attach the battery ground cable and push the front seats to their rear position. One should drain the back up power supply by disconnecting the battery ground wire and waiting at least one minute while making sure all auxiliary batteries remain disconnected. You should disconnect the restraint system diagnostic tool from its location on the passenger air bag electrical connector in the instrument panel. Use the glove box opening to connect the electrical connector of the passenger air bag module by securing its locking clip. Move on to install the glove compartment and door then extract the diagnostic tool from the steering column Clock Spring electrical connector at its top position. Place the driver air bag module onto the Steering Wheel while constructing the electrical connections through its locking clip and fastening the two driver air bag module bolts and steering wheel back cover plugs. Complete your vehicle road use by reconnecting the battery ground cable but ensure immediate removal of the diagnostic tool from the vehicle to maintain both safety and compliance with standards. Check the Supplemental Restraint System operation by removing diagnostic tools from all deployable devices.
  • Q: What precautions should be taken when servicing a side air bag module on Ford Thunderbird?
    A:
    Safety glasses serve as protection for your eyes when servicing a side air bag module since accidental deployments can harm you. A proper handling technique requires the side air bag module to stay pointed towards your body with the air bag and tear seam away from you and never place it on the tear seam. A complete hand washing procedure should follow deployment to eliminate sodium hydroxide traces. Probing the connectors of the air bag module leads to automatic deployment of the air bag. A vehicle with a supplemental restraint system (SRS) component requires at least a depowered and operational SRS before returning it to the customer. A deployment requires replacement of seat back pads and trim covers as well as side air bag modules while installing a new seat back frame if required. Start by taking out the seat from the side of the issue and disabling the system power. First disconnect the J-clip on the backrest trim cover while making note of the wire harness path for the side air bag module and lumbar system. The installer should throw away the hog rings before carefully untangling the trim cover from the hook and loop strip without creating material damage. Proceed with peeling back the trim cover until reaching the side air bag through the space between the backrest foam pad. Remove both electrical connectors from the side air bag module while detaching its pin-type retainers. Thoroughly disengage the wires from the side air bag module but never detach the permanent wire connector. A new set of retaining nuts must be installed when putting in a new side air bag module while retaining the original nuts becomes necessary when using the existing module. Take out the side air bag module together with its two retaining nuts. A thorough inspection of all mounting surfaces and side air bag cavity must be performed along with a damage check of the air bag module before any installation takes place. Install the new or reused side air bag module together with the wire harness into the seat back cushion through the outboard opening before tightening all mounting nuts to 8 Nm (71 lb-in). It is essential to change damaged pin-type retainers since they affect wire harness routing integrity. The seat cushion pan gets a side air bag wire harness for installation and you should connect the electrical connector. The proper installation of the side air bag needs stainless steel hog rings because they provide the correct positioning. Secure the seat back trim cover through the installation of hog rings before fastening J-clips. To complete this task replace the seat while powering up the system and verify that the active restraint functions correctly.
